The rent covers 77% of the payment — you top up about 196 €/mo for 20 years. From rent alone, with no loan, it pays for itself in 24 years. Calculated from the median rent for the neighbourhood, at full occupancy and before running costs — a benchmark, not a guarantee.
This apartment is priced about 36,000 € below the typical price (the median) for 2-room apartments in Mladost 2 (67 properties) — 2,301 €/m² against 2,727 €/m².
2-room apartment in a new residential complex in Mladost 2, Sofia. The property is part of a project located near schools and a park, with a convenient urban location.
The layout is functional with an area of 85 sq m, suitable for a first home or investment. The apartment is on the 5th floor of a total of 10, with the possibility to install underfloor heating and air conditioning systems.
The building is brick, construction planned for completion in 2029, equipped with elevator, video surveillance, and controlled access. Underground parking spaces and garages are planned.
The location offers quick access to public transport, metro station, and commercial facilities, while providing a green environment around the complex.
The property is suitable for those seeking a combination of urban amenities and tranquility in a gated community.
